Templegate has provided his top picks for Sunday’s horse racing events, focusing on four standout horses. Hermetic is his nap selection, a son of Sea The Stars, who is expected to perform well over a two-mile distance for the first time in the UK after a promising debut for his new stable at York. Brosay, another contender, will be ridden by Oisin Murphy and has recently dropped in weight, making him a strong candidate despite a lackluster outing at Carlisle. Hamish is also highlighted, aiming to continue his winning streak after three victories at Listed level, and is anticipated to enjoy favorable conditions. Finally, Flying Ace, who recently won by five lengths at Cartmel, is expected to excel with the added distance in his upcoming race at Perth.
